The BC Nurses' Union (BCNU) is a strong, dynamic voice for nurses and nursing in British Columbia, representing more than 50,000 members. BCNU provides collective agreement negotiation and support to its members, as well as professional and advocacy services in the field of research, clinical practice, leadership and education. As the voice of the nursing profession in the province, we advocate for nurses and patients to ensure safe, quality, public health care for all.

Position Overview



Responsible for providing administrative support for Labour Relations, Classifications, and other Officers, as required, as well as for standing/ad hoc committees. This position is under general supervision and operates with independence. The incumbent receives new assignments in the form of verbal, written or email guidelines from a number of officers and other union staff, and is required to exercise initiative in the organization of their related duties.



Key Responsibilities



Provides administrative support to staff or committees as assigned.

Drafts and prepares correspondence for signature. This may be routine, specialized, or confidential in nature. Proofreads and edits newly negotiated or renewed collective agreements. Sets up and distributes copies of meeting notices, agendas, and correspondence. Creates, develops, reviews, and provides grievance arbitration or advocacy reports. May perform research for cases in databases and on the internet. Works within the computerized network system. Uses technology for various applications, such as database management and word processing.

Handles inquiries and requests from members and staff.

Makes and receives enquiries, takes and relays messages and information to a wide variety of contacts. Receives new assignments in the form of verbal, written, or email guidelines from officers and other union staff. Establishes their own priorities within the framework of assignments received and resolves work assignment conflicts with team Coordinator. Deals with time sensitive issues effectively.

Sets up and maintains filing systems.

Sets up and maintains filing systems; maintains up to date records of union functions, staff assignments, meetings, and grievance logs.

Coordinates scheduling, meetings, and travel.

Arranges meetings, facility appointments, travel, and accommodation.

Performs other related duties as assigned.



Qualifications



The successful applicant must have:



1. A diploma or certificate in Business Administration or Applied Business Technology and three years of experience in an office environment or an equivalent combination of education, training, and experience.

2. Current knowledge of standard office methods and procedures. Demonstrated ability to effectively utilize MS Office.

3. Ability to manage correspondence and research information.

4. Ability to create and document processes.

5. Ability to format, filter, and index information.

6. Ability to communicate effectively both verbally and in writing.

7. Ability to organize work.

8. Ability to problem solve.

9. Ability to deal with others effectively.

10. Ability to simultaneously listen and record minutes.

11. Ability to type a minimum of 65 wpm.
